The Complexity of Wind Damage Claims


​Wind damage claims can seem straightforward—your property gets damaged, you file a claim, and then you get compensated. Yet, it's anything but simple. The complexity of these claims often stems from the nature of wind damage itself. It can be partial or total, visible or hidden. Identifying the full extent of the damage goes beyond what meets the eye. It's not just about snapped trees or torn roofs; it can also be about the less obvious harm that wind and debris have caused to the structure of a building.

Insurers are no strangers to this complexity and sometimes, unfortunately, use it to their advantage. They might argue that some of the damages were pre-existing or not entirely due to the wind. Proving otherwise requires evidence, expertise, and a deep understanding of how these claims work.

Moreover, policy language about wind damage can be dense and confusing. What's covered and what's not isn't always black and white. Interpretations can vary, leading to disagreements between you and your insurance company. These disputes over coverage, the extent of damage, and the cost of repairs create a minefield that's tough to navigate without professional help.

​The Role of a Claims Adjuster in Wind Damage Cases


​In wind damage cases, a claims adjuster is the person you’ll meet first when filing a claim with your insurance. They play a big role. Think of them as the point person for the insurance company. Their job is to check out your property, assess the damage, and figure out how much the insurance should pay. It sounds straightforward, right? But here's the kicker. The adjuster works for the insurance company, not for you. That means they're looking to settle your claim for as little as possible. They’ll scrutinize every detail of the damage, and sometimes, they might not see things the way you do. ​Common Pitfalls in Managing Wind Damage Claims Alone

​​Managing wind damage claims by yourself can be like trying to sail a ship without a compass. First, it's easy to underestimate the extent of the damage. You might miss hidden damages that aren't obvious but are costly to fix. Second, paperwork can trip you up. Filing a claim involves loads of paperwork, and one mistake can delay your claim or even lead to a denial. Third, you might not know the real value of your claim. Without knowledge of what you're truly entitled to, you could end up accepting a settlement that’s way below what’s fair. Lastly, meeting the insurance company’s deadlines can be tough. They have strict timelines that can be hard to manage on your own, especially when you're dealing with the stress of wind damage. In short, going it alone can lead to missed damages, paperwork errors, lowball settlements, and missed deadlines.
